Nutritional and Nutraceutical Richness of Unexploited Folk Aromatic Rice Landraces from Eastern Ghats of India

The study of genetic diversity in folk rice landraces is essential for advancing future breeding programs. This study assessed the nutritional compositions of unexploited folk rice landraces of Eastern Ghats of India and compared these with Pusa Basmati, Sugandha, and IR 64 (improved varieties). The proximate parameters such as moisture content ranged from 8.39 to 10.51 g/100 g, ash from 0.76 to 2.87 g/100 g, fat from 1.03 to 2.57 g/100 g, protein from 7.18 to 11.44 g/100 g, carbohydrate from 75.33 to 80.18 g/100 g, fiber from 0.55 to 2.42 g/100 g, and energy from 353 to 368 kcal/100 g. The glycemic index, hydrolysis index, and amylose content ranged from 55.27 to 64.64, 28.34 to 45.41, and 16.26 to 49.65 g/100 g, respectively, across the landraces. The initial two principal components showed 33.1% of the total variation, highlighting significant variations among the genotypes. Phenol, antioxidants, vitamin C, fiber, flavonoid, and iron showed the highest positive loadings and were major determinants of phenotypic variability. The heritability ranged from 61.64 to 99.99%, while the genetic advance varied from 3.20 to 141.01%. Notably, certain folk landraces such as Dudhamani, Dubraj, Bastabhoga, and Kalajeera exhibited exceptional richness in energy content, indicating their nutritional superiority compared to others. Kalajeera, Kuyerkuling, and Tikichudi also demonstrated enhanced levels of fiber, iron, flavonoid, and antioxidants. These nutrient-rich landraces are better genetic resources for future rice improvement.
